Preparation: In a high-sided saucepan over medium-high heat, bring cold water and sugar to a boil. Turn the heat to low and stir constantly until the sugar dissolves completely and the mixture is clear, approximately 3 to 5 minutes. Remember – the longer you boil it, the thicker the syrup will be when cooled.

Before cutting, dip the bottom of your pan in … WebJul 26, 2024 · Yes, thick water is healthy and made for people who have problems swallowing. Thin liquid or food can go into their air canals and they can have issues breathing. So, thick water is a healthy alternative for them to ensure proper swallowing of their food. They are even advised to take such foods that have a thick composition.

Use Flour and Water Combine 2 tablespoons flour with every 1/4 cup cold water and whisk until smooth. Add the mixture to your sauce over medium heat, and continue to stir and cook until you’ve reached your desired consistency. Test with a spoon.
